5 inch version of the famous Roundshot cameras.
Technical data:
Rodenstock Grandagon MC 4,5/ 65mm.
Total shift of lens available is 25mm.
79 degrees vertical picture angle.
Focus at 3m, 5m ,10m and infinity.
Shutterspeeds 1/250 to 4s, which corresponds to a full rotation from 1 second to 16 minutes.
Takes 5"x50ft film for a total 35 exp of 360 degrees.
One 360 degree image is 414mm x110mm (3,76:1).
One of a dozen cameras made in 1984 at the price of a decent car. Looking at the serial number this is one of the last one built.
